Welcome to the Lanternleaf consent banner program. Plugin authors must register each banner variant before rollout so the Driftgate compliance checker can validate copy, locale coverage, and dismissal behavior. Please test against the staging consent ledger rather than production; consent records are immutable once written, and malformed entries cannot be purged without a formal review. To connect your local plugin harness to the staging ledger, configure your client with the connection string below.

replica DSN, hadug-yajep: postgresql://aldiel_svc:W4u8z42Jo5IFtG@db-1656.torvacorp.local:5432/holael

CI Troubleshooting — Pointsmith Loyalty Ledger

If the ledger reconciliation job fails on your first run, check that the fixture database was reseeded; stale balances cause off-by-one point totals. Rerun the seed step, then the reconcile stage, before filing anything. When escalating to the Fennwick platform team, include the logs plus the build token shown directly below.

pipeline stamp: htk4_ae36

Welcome aboard. The Q3 forecast for Brindlewood Fixtures assumes stable receivables from our two largest accounts and a modest seasonal dip in September. I have flagged the Marwick Lane warehouse lease renewal as the main sensitivity; if renegotiation slips, the cash buffer narrows to roughly three weeks. Margret Olsen in treasury maintains the rolling model and updates it each Friday. Please review her assumptions on stock intake before sign-off. The confidential note below summarises the related business plans.

internal memo for kaduf-baduf: Only 35 of the 378 pilot accounts renewed Holir, so a churn review is set for June 11. Eliielax Group is in early talks to buy Silaelix Group for about $142.1 million.

# Break-Glass: Catalog Cache Invalidation

Scope: the Pinrow product catalog at Veldstone Retail. If stale prices persist after a purge and the Hollowmere invalidation queue is wedged, use break-glass to flush the edge tier directly. Contractors: get verbal sign-off from the catalog lead first. Steps: open the Hollowmere admin shell, select emergency-flush, confirm the tenant, and run it once — repeated flushes thrash the origin. Access is logged and expires after 20 minutes. Unseal the admin shell with the passphrase below.

recovery phrase for kahop-tajog: istix-casvan